Ok so i was changing my spark plugs today and i noticed on some of the spark plugs in the front and back had some small amount of oil on them. I feel that it is a leaking seal but which seal could it most likely be? Or is it something else? I was having a hesitation problem at low rpm and figured it was the plugs or the wires. (Just hope its not the wires because i just bought them in the last group buy they had)Your help is appreciated.

Is it "wet" oil or does it resemble carbon? Do you think the oil ran down the threads from the plug well and wet up the plugs as you were removing them? Usually plugs wet with oil means the rings are worn. Valve stem seals and guides will usually burn up and leave puffy oil deposits. Have someone ride behind you as an observer. Get on the gas then let off on it suddenly. If smoke comes out when gassing it, it's the rings. If it smokes when off, it's the valve stem or seals. Vacuum is high when off the throttle so the engine sucks the oil from the guides.

Oil on the outside part of the plug usually come from the spark plug well gasket part of the valve cover gasket.
